在人工智能技术飞速发展的2025年,AI编程助手已成为开发者工具箱中不可或缺的一部分。李响团队基于大量开发者反馈撰写本文,力求客观公正地评估当前主流的AI代码生成工具,不涉及商业推广。

在这里插入图片描述

为什么需要AI编程助手?

现代软件开发面临着日益复杂的业务逻辑和紧迫的开发周期。根据开发者社区调研,使用AI编程工具能够:

  • 提升40%以上的编码效率
  • 减少60%的重复性代码编写
  • 降低35%的语法错误率
  • 加速学习新语言和框架的过程

主流AI编程工具全面对比

GitHub Copilot:老牌劲旅的进化

核心特点:

  • 深度集成VS Code、JetBrains全家桶等主流IDE
  • 支持30+编程语言
  • 基于OpenAI技术,代码建议精准度高

优势:

  • 生态成熟,插件丰富
  • 代码补全响应速度快
  • 与GitHub生态系统无缝衔接

不足:

  • 需要订阅费用
  • 对复杂业务逻辑理解有限
  • 生成的代码有时需要较多调整

适用场景: 日常编码辅助、快速原型开发、学习新框架

Cursor:AI优先的编辑器

核心特点:

  • 基于ChatGPT的智能代码生成
  • 内置AI聊天功能,可直接对话修改代码
  • 支持代码库级别的理解

优势:

  • 自然语言交互体验优秀
  • 代码重构能力强
  • 对整体项目结构理解深入

不足:

  • 需要联网使用
  • 大型项目响应速度较慢
  • 学习成本相对较高

适用场景: 代码重构、项目迁移、复杂逻辑实现

CodeWhisperer:亚马逊的AI利器

核心特点:

  • 深度集成AWS服务
  • 安全性检查功能
  • 开源代码引用提示

优势:

  • 对AWS生态支持最佳
  • 代码安全检测实用
  • 个人版免费

不足:

  • 非AWS场景优势不明显
  • 代码生成多样性不足

适用场景: 云原生开发、AWS项目、企业级应用

在这里插入图片描述

新兴力量:Lynx AI智能全栈开发平台

在深入测评多款工具后,李响团队发现了一个值得特别关注的新兴工具——Lynx AI。

什么是Lynx AI?

Lynx AI是领先的智能全栈应用开发平台,用户只需通过自然语言描述需求,即可自动生成前端页面、后端逻辑和数据库结构。无需代码基础,无需环境配置——所有操作在浏览器中完成,一键部署全站。

Lynx AI的核心优势

特性 说明
全栈生成 同时生成前端、后端和数据库
零基础友好 无需编程经验,自然语言驱动
多端自适应 UI精细,布局自适应多端
一键部署 在线完成开发到部署全流程
生态集成 支持与主流CMS框架结合

适用人群广泛

对于零基础用户:

  • 个人博主快速搭建网站
  • 小微企业创建业务系统
  • 工作室制作客户演示

对于专业开发者:

  • 产品经理30秒生成应用原型
  • UI设计师快速实现设计效果
  • 开发者提高工作效率

实际应用案例

某个人工作室需要开发会员管理系统,通过向Lynx AI描述:“开发一个会员系统,支持移动端预约、支付和积分管理”,在几分钟内就获得了完整可用的应用,包括:

  • 响应式前端界面
  • 会员管理后端逻辑
  • 积分和支付数据库结构
  • 可直接部署的完整项目

2025年AI编程工具选择指南

根据需求匹配工具

使用场景 推荐工具 理由
日常编码辅助 GitHub Copilot 生态成熟,响应快速
代码重构优化 Cursor 项目级理解,重构能力强
全栈应用开发 Lynx AI 覆盖前后端,一键部署
云原生项目 CodeWhisperer AWS生态集成度高

在这里插入图片描述

选择建议

李响团队建议开发者根据实际需求选择工具:

  • 先明确自身开发场景和技能水平
  • 再试用不同工具的免费版本
  • 最后根据体验效果决定长期使用方案

对于编程初学者或需要快速搭建完整应用的用户,可以优先体验Lynx AI的在线demo;而对于有经验的开发者,Copilot和Cursor的组合使用可能效果更佳。

未来展望

随着AI技术的不断发展,2025年的编程工具正朝着更加智能、集成的方向发展。从单纯的代码补全到全栈应用生成,AI正在彻底改变软件开发的范式。

开发者应当保持开放心态,积极尝试新技术,但同时也要认识到,AI工具是增强而非替代人类开发者的创造力和解决问题的能力。


本文由李响团队基于大量开发者用户反馈撰写,力求客观公正,不涉及商业推广。实际选择AI编程工具时,建议先明确自身开发需求,再体验不同工具的免费版本,找到最适合自己的解决方案。

Logo

汇聚全球AI编程工具,助力开发者即刻编程。

更多推荐